diff --git a/runtime/starpu/codelets/codelet_zgemm.c b/runtime/starpu/codelets/codelet_zgemm.c index 549c609ecf392fc5bb199a27fecfc85a7f5f1b54..53f241f899d219846396b802e54a27df9eeeb749 100644 --- a/runtime/starpu/codelets/codelet_zgemm.c +++ b/runtime/starpu/codelets/codelet_zgemm.c @@ -195,6 +195,7 @@ void INSERT_TASK_zgemm_Astat( const RUNTIME_option_t *options, } #if defined(CHAMELEON_KERNELS_TRACE) + if ( clargs != NULL ) { char *cl_fullname; chameleon_asprintf( &cl_fullname, "%s( %s, %s, %s )", cl_name, clargs->tileA->name, clargs->tileB->name, clargs->tileC->name ); @@ -271,9 +272,11 @@ void INSERT_TASK_zgemm( const RUNTIME_option_t *options, accessC = ( beta == 0. ) ? STARPU_W : (STARPU_RW | ((beta == 1.) ? STARPU_COMMUTE : 0)); #if defined(CHAMELEON_KERNELS_TRACE) + if ( clargs != NULL ) { char *cl_fullname; - chameleon_asprintf( &cl_fullname, "%s( %s, %s, %s )", cl_name, clargs->tileA->name, clargs->tileB->name, clargs->tileC->name ); + chameleon_asprintf( &cl_fullname, "%s( %s, %s, %s )", cl_name, + clargs->tileA->name, clargs->tileB->name, clargs->tileC->name ); cl_name = cl_fullname; } #endif diff --git a/runtime/starpu/codelets/codelet_zhemm.c b/runtime/starpu/codelets/codelet_zhemm.c index de82bcce360c5d20759b66ff53316b54e361a496..52b923f98b8438431a8091adaee3294105158b29 100644 --- a/runtime/starpu/codelets/codelet_zhemm.c +++ b/runtime/starpu/codelets/codelet_zhemm.c @@ -186,6 +186,7 @@ void INSERT_TASK_zhemm_Astat( const RUNTIME_option_t *options, } #if defined(CHAMELEON_KERNELS_TRACE) + if ( clargs != NULL ) { char *cl_fullname; chameleon_asprintf( &cl_fullname, "%s( %s, %s, %s )", cl_name, clargs->tileA->name, clargs->tileB->name, clargs->tileC->name ); @@ -261,6 +262,7 @@ void INSERT_TASK_zhemm( const RUNTIME_option_t *options, accessC = ( beta == 0. ) ? STARPU_W : (STARPU_RW | ((beta == 1.) ? STARPU_COMMUTE : 0)); #if defined(CHAMELEON_KERNELS_TRACE) + if ( clargs != NULL ) { char *cl_fullname; chameleon_asprintf( &cl_fullname, "%s( %s, %s, %s )", cl_name, clargs->tileA->name, clargs->tileB->name, clargs->tileC->name ); diff --git a/runtime/starpu/codelets/codelet_zherk.c b/runtime/starpu/codelets/codelet_zherk.c index 29301b83097c8b61383c00861777c35917ac27cd..19bf62ba2146006361df47daef4c2f95e8e84850 100644 --- a/runtime/starpu/codelets/codelet_zherk.c +++ b/runtime/starpu/codelets/codelet_zherk.c @@ -151,6 +151,7 @@ void INSERT_TASK_zherk( const RUNTIME_option_t *options, accessC = ( beta == 0. ) ? STARPU_W : STARPU_RW; #if defined(CHAMELEON_KERNELS_TRACE) + if ( clargs != NULL ) { char *cl_fullname; chameleon_asprintf( &cl_fullname, "%s( %s, %s )", cl_name, clargs->tileA->name, clargs->tileC->name ); diff --git a/runtime/starpu/codelets/codelet_zsymm.c b/runtime/starpu/codelets/codelet_zsymm.c index 3000eb17d8f5795faa57ba48eef9c01a6c32a58b..0012ed7d1b67b339419ae437f5fd464e79d3a29e 100644 --- a/runtime/starpu/codelets/codelet_zsymm.c +++ b/runtime/starpu/codelets/codelet_zsymm.c @@ -187,6 +187,7 @@ void INSERT_TASK_zsymm_Astat( const RUNTIME_option_t *options, } #if defined(CHAMELEON_KERNELS_TRACE) + if ( clargs != NULL ) { char *cl_fullname; chameleon_asprintf( &cl_fullname, "%s( %s, %s, %s )", cl_name, clargs->tileA->name, clargs->tileB->name, clargs->tileC->name ); @@ -262,6 +263,7 @@ void INSERT_TASK_zsymm( const RUNTIME_option_t *options, accessC = ( beta == 0. ) ? STARPU_W : (STARPU_RW | ((beta == 1.) ? STARPU_COMMUTE : 0)); #if defined(CHAMELEON_KERNELS_TRACE) + if ( clargs != NULL ) { char *cl_fullname; chameleon_asprintf( &cl_fullname, "%s( %s, %s, %s )", cl_name, clargs->tileA->name, clargs->tileB->name, clargs->tileC->name ); diff --git a/runtime/starpu/codelets/codelet_zsyrk.c b/runtime/starpu/codelets/codelet_zsyrk.c index 4df1a23030b6fc74f5816197878a5854c07be3c0..863e28648b0745d347801078f2417a787ba7df6a 100644 --- a/runtime/starpu/codelets/codelet_zsyrk.c +++ b/runtime/starpu/codelets/codelet_zsyrk.c @@ -152,6 +152,7 @@ void INSERT_TASK_zsyrk( const RUNTIME_option_t *options, accessC = ( beta == 0. ) ? STARPU_W : STARPU_RW; #if defined(CHAMELEON_KERNELS_TRACE) + if ( clargs != NULL ) { char *cl_fullname; chameleon_asprintf( &cl_fullname, "%s( %s, %s )", cl_name, clargs->tileA->name, clargs->tileC->name ); diff --git a/runtime/starpu/codelets/codelet_ztrmm.c b/runtime/starpu/codelets/codelet_ztrmm.c index ec98d97574cb16d54704264a14d9120e5571a979..c9f4ea32b5fb2fc4c22811247a3b9907182523e1 100644 --- a/runtime/starpu/codelets/codelet_ztrmm.c +++ b/runtime/starpu/codelets/codelet_ztrmm.c @@ -142,6 +142,7 @@ void INSERT_TASK_ztrmm( const RUNTIME_option_t *options, callback = options->profiling ? cl_ztrmm_callback : NULL; #if defined(CHAMELEON_KERNELS_TRACE) + if ( clargs != NULL ) { char *cl_fullname; chameleon_asprintf( &cl_fullname, "%s( %s, %s )", cl_name, clargs->tileA->name, clargs->tileB->name ); diff --git a/runtime/starpu/codelets/codelet_ztrsm.c b/runtime/starpu/codelets/codelet_ztrsm.c index d4c063b0d3069276c251e0f47f33556c0cb11ab2..1ce23594d3f7928c03ba049e9ee043abee4c7c5a 100644 --- a/runtime/starpu/codelets/codelet_ztrsm.c +++ b/runtime/starpu/codelets/codelet_ztrsm.c @@ -147,6 +147,7 @@ void INSERT_TASK_ztrsm( const RUNTIME_option_t *options, callback = options->profiling ? cl_ztrsm_callback : NULL; #if defined(CHAMELEON_KERNELS_TRACE) + if ( clargs != NULL ) { char *cl_fullname; chameleon_asprintf( &cl_fullname, "%s( %s, %s )", cl_name, clargs->tileA->name, clargs->tileB->name );